The Pilot in Command (PIC) has the ultimate responsibility for ensuring the aircraft is operated safely, compliantly, and efficiently. The PIC adheres to all company and regulatory requirements while providing an exceptional service experience.
Tasks and Responsibilities:
- Ensures the safe operation of flight, including compliant crewing and trip assignments.
- Completes flight planning, performance, and weight and balance tasks.
- Utilizes Threats, Plans, and Considerations (TPC) briefing methodology to lead briefings and mitigate operational risks.
- Complies with company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) and coordinates with company personnel. Acts as the Grounds Security and In-Flight Security Coordinator as defined by company policy.
- Completes all aircraft pre-flight tasks, ensuring mission capability and recording discrepancies.
- Monitors and ensures all aircraft ground servicing items (fueling, oil, oxygen) are accomplished per SOPs.
- Completes passenger briefings, delivers superior customer service, and meets special passenger needs.
- Utilizes Crew Resource Management (CRM) and Threat and Error Management (TEM) for clear and timely communication during normal, abnormal, and emergency operations.
- Provides quality service to owners and passengers, identifying opportunities to enhance the Executive Jet Management service experience and resolving service deviations.
- Collaborates with crew members and internal partners to provide a consistent service experience and resolves conflicts acceptably.
- Maintains regulatory and company-required training and recency of experience.
- Complies with the company SMS program and reports safety or non-compliance concerns.
Certifications and Licenses:
- FAA Airline Transport Pilot (ATP) Certificate
- First Class Medical Certificate
Years of Experience:
4-6 years of experience
Knowledge, Skills, Abilities and Other (KSAOs):
- Prior experience in corporate/business aviation preferred.
- FAA Type rating in EMB-550.
- Must be able to perform the essential functions of the position.
- Minimum Time Requirements:
- Total flight time: 3500 hours
- Multi Engine Land (MEL): 1500 hours
- Pilot in Command: 2000 hours
- PIC MEL: 500 hours
- Instrument: 300 hours
- Jet: 500 hours
